Output ef025039c175ebe70d6024193184b3d31198c2891f8a42f0504706813c770518:55

value
31000
script pubkey
OP_0 OP_PUSHBYTES_20 2c4c7fad53eac8437a17144c09f89684fa098fe9
address
ltc1q93x8lt2natyyx7shz3xqn7yksnaqnrlfdfe2hr
transaction
ef025039c175ebe70d6024193184b3d31198c2891f8a42f0504706813c770518
spent
true